A SERIOUS collision on the M1 in Bedfordshire is causing delays for motorists.

The carriageway was closed in both directions today as emergency services attended the scene.

Delays were caused by a multi-vehicle collision at around 1.30pm today

The northbound carriageway was closed temporarily and has since reopened, while the southbound direction remains closed.

The closure is between J13 near Bedford , and J12 Flitwick.

It concerns a multi-vehicle collision that occurred at around 1.30pm today.

The closure is to allow air ambulance to attend the scene.

Bedfordshire Police , Bedfordshire Fire and Rescue Service, East of England Ambulance Service and East Anglian Air Ambulance were all in attendance.

Bedfordshire Police remain on site while an investigation is carried out.

It wrote on X : “We are currently at the scene of a serious collision on the M1.

“Emergency services were called shortly after 1.30pm today (Sunday) following reports of a collision between junctions 13 and 14 on the southbound carriageway.

“A full closure of the southbound carriageway is currently in place. The northbound carriageway is temporarily closed to allow the air ambulance to attend the scene.

“We would like to thank everyone affected by the closures for their patience, and we ask anyone planning to use the M1 to seek alternative routes at this time.”

National Highways Traffic Officers are assisting with traffic management at the scene.

Drivers have been advised to find an alternative route for their journey.

National Highways wrote: “If this closure impacts on your planned route, please allow extra journey time. Plan ahead, you may wish to re-route or even delay your journey.”

A Hollow Square diversion symbol is being used to re-route drivers.
